Full cast and crew for
Going My Way (1944)

Directed by
Leo McCarey 
 
Writing credits
Leo McCarey (story)

Frank Butler (screenplay) and
Frank Cavett (screenplay)

Cast (in credits order) complete, awaiting verification

Bing Crosby ... Father Chuck O'Malley
Barry Fitzgerald ... Father Fitzgibbon
Frank McHugh ... Father Timothy O'Dowd
James Brown ... Ted Haines Jr.

Gene Lockhart ... Ted Haines Sr.
Jean Heather ... Carol James
Porter Hall ... Mr. Belknap
Fortunio Bonanova ... Tomaso Bozanni
Eily Malyon ... Mrs. Carmody
The Robert Mitchell Boy Choir ... Choir
Risë Stevens ... Genevieve Linden
